Skip to content

jeremiahpantaras/recivo

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

35 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

🧾 Recivo

Recivo is a modern receipt generation platform designed specifically for online sellers and business owners. Create, manage, and share professional receipts in seconds—without the hassle of manual paperwork.


🌟 Overview

In today's fast-paced e-commerce landscape, online sellers need quick and professional solutions for documenting transactions. Recivo bridges that gap by providing an intuitive platform that transforms your sales data into polished, shareable receipts instantly.

Whether you're running a small online shop, managing multiple businesses, or scaling your e-commerce operations, Recivo streamlines your receipt workflow so you can focus on what matters most—growing your business.


🎯 Key Features

📱 Cross-Platform Accessibility

  • Web-based dashboard for desktop management
  • Mobile app for on-the-go receipt generation
  • Seamless sync across all your devices

Instant Receipt Generation

  • Create professional receipts in seconds
  • Pre-built templates for various business types
  • Customizable branding with your logo and colors

🏢 Multi-Business Management

  • Manage receipts for multiple businesses from one account
  • Separate product catalogs per business
  • Individual business settings and branding

📦 Product Catalog

  • Store frequently sold items
  • Quick-add products to receipts
  • Track pricing and descriptions

🔐 Secure & Reliable

  • Firebase Authentication for secure access
  • Cloud-based storage—never lose a receipt
  • Real-time data synchronization

📊 Smart Organization

  • Search and filter receipts by date, customer, or amount
  • Export receipts in multiple formats
  • Archive old receipts for clean organization

🛠️ Tech Stack

Frontend

  • Web: React + TypeScript + Vite
  • Mobile: React Native + TypeScript
  • Styling: Tailwind CSS v4
  • State Management: Zustand
  • Routing: React Router

Backend

  • API: NestJS (TypeScript)
  • Authentication: Firebase Auth
  • Database: Cloud Firestore
  • Storage: Firebase Storage (planned)

DevOps

  • Version Control: Git
  • Hosting: Firebase Hosting (web)
  • API Deployment: Cloud hosting service

🎨 Design Philosophy

Recivo follows a clean, minimal, and intuitive design approach:

  • Mobile-First: Optimized for sellers who work on mobile devices
  • Speed: Fast load times and instant interactions
  • Accessibility: Easy to use for sellers of all tech levels
  • Professional: Generate receipts that look trustworthy and polished

📋 Use Cases

For Online Sellers

  • Generate receipts after marketplace sales
  • Document peer-to-peer transactions
  • Provide professional proof of purchase to customers

For Small Businesses

  • Replace manual receipt writing
  • Maintain digital records of all transactions
  • Brand your receipts with business details

For E-commerce Entrepreneurs

  • Manage multiple online stores
  • Quick receipt generation during fulfillment
  • Professional customer communication

🎯 Roadmap

  • Project setup and architecture
  • Firebase authentication
  • User registration and login
  • Receipt generation engine
  • Product catalog management
  • Multi-business support
  • Receipt templates library
  • Export functionality (PDF, image)
  • Mobile app development
  • Cloud storage integration
  • Analytics dashboard
  • Receipt sharing via email/SMS

🤝 Contributing

Recivo is currently in active development. Contributions, suggestions, and feedback are welcome!


📄 License

This project is proprietary and confidential.


💬 Contact

For questions or support, please reach out to the development team.


About

Recivo is a modern receipt generation platform designed specifically for online sellers and business owners. Create, manage, and share professional receipts in seconds—without the hassle of manual paperwork.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ors